Mulin Chao
1cc73074d0 driver: gpio: npcx: fixed leakage current in npcx7 series.
It was found that npcx7 series' GPIOs which support low-voltage power
supply, there is an excessive power consumption if they are selected to
low-voltage mode and their input voltage is 1.8V.

To avoid this excessive power consumption, this CL suspends the
connection between IO pads and hardware instances before ec enters deep
sleep mode. Then restore them after waking up.

Peter Bigot
c26cdb7409 drivers: flash: spi-nor: add support for 4-byte addressing
Add a function that uses the JESD216 SFDP BFP DW16 Enter 4-Byte
Addressing parameter to put the device into 4-byte addressing mode if
one of the entry modes that's supported by the driver is available on
the device.

Perform the transition if SFDP data is provided (either by devicetree
or at runtime), or if a special devicetree property provides the entry
mode descriptor.

Peter Bigot
e0f514f670 drivers: flash: spi_nor: support 32-bit addresses in access method
Support both 24-bit and 32-bit address values when constructing the
device command.  Note that some commands require 24-bit address
regardless of mode, and some require 32-bit addresses regardless of
mode, so provide command-specific overrides of a generic (but not yet
configurable) default address size.

With this we no longer need a special interface for READ_SFDP which
uses a 24-bit address but with a wait state introduced by clocking out
a fifth command byte.

Mario Jaun
c276088567 drivers: ethernet: stm32: SRAM3 / MPU configuration
Fixes #29915.

Implements the memory layout and MPU configuration for Ethernet buffers
for STM32H7 controllers as recommended by ST. 16 KB of SRAM3 are
are reserved for this. The first 256 B are for the RX/TX descriptors and
configured as strongly ordered, shareable memory. The rest is for RX/TX
buffers and configured as non cacheable memory. This configuration is
automatically applied for H7 chips if the SRAM3 memory is enabled in the
device tree.

Thomas Stranger
1e3512c94e drivers/dma: stm32: don't omit IRQ status check in dma_is_irq_active
Fix stm32_dma_is_irq_active not checking the IRQ status(IsEnabled) for
active interrupts.
While the transfer-complete, half-transfer comp.  and transfer-error
is_XX_irq_active() functions check for IRQ status (IsEnabled),
ORing the result with dma_stm32_is_gi_active() overrides the
status check as gi is always 1 in case any of these flags is active.

Thomas Stranger
5a475d7cc2 drivers/dma: stm32: add support for stm32g0 series
Update the existing driver to support STM32G0 series.
It enables the DMA_STM32_SHARED_IRQS flag for g0 series, such that
all interrupts are handled in a shared isr to avoid irq conflicts.
The shared isr is extended to be able to handle irqs from more than one
dma instance.

Furthermore the config_irq function of instance 1, which connects to the
irqs, was reworked to avoid irq conflicts when 2 dma instances on
stm32f0, or stm32g0 are enabled:
While dma1 has one exclusive irq for channel 1, and one irq for dma1
channels 2 and 3, all other channels share the same irq.
Therefore it is currently not possible to enable dma2 without enabling
dma1 at the same time, without getting an build errror due to an irq
conflict.
